Henk van Muijen, Managing Director, IHC Mining

Henk van Muijen is the managing director at MTI Holland (The Knowledge Centre of IHC Merwede). He started his career at MTI Holland in 1984 as junior project manager and joined IHC’s mining department as product manager in 1986. He worked as the manager of the technical department of IHC Mining from 1990 to 1993, at which point he was promoted to senior project manager at MTI Holland. His work involved an array of dredging and mineral processing projects including conducting environmental impact assessments and cleanups, selecting proper dredging and mining equipment, controlling dredging related to constituent processing steps and business development of mineral processing projects.

In 2001 Mr. Henk became the manager of The Training Institute for Dredging (TID) where he successfully developed the international dredge training market and increased TID’s market share. He was appointed General Manager of MTI Holland, IHC Holland’s R&D Institute, in 2005. Mr. Henk continues to hold an important position with TID due to its close relationship with MTI Holland. He is a lecturer at several TID courses and at the Delft University of Technology. Mr. Henk has published many significant writings on dredge mining and mineral processing and is an active member of the Royal Dutch Institute of Engineers and the Dutch EEZ Taskforce.
